(5) At-start reverse rotation homing profile2
The motion occurs in the direction opposite to the homing direction after reference signal detection
(direction of home position when viewed from the reference signal for homing) to detect the
reference signal for homing (deceleration starting signal) and reference signal for shift operation.
This profile is used if the machine stopping position is larger than the reference signal for homing
or reference signal for homing.

Because rotation reverses in the direction opposite to the OT direction upon OT detection to
detect the reference signal for homing (deceleration starting signal) and reference signal for shift
operation, secure homing is realized. The reverse rotation after OT detection follows (2) OT
reference homing profile.
The direction of movement is defined as follows.
Forward: direction of position increase Reverse: direction of position decrease.
